Subject[PATCH 0/2] iommu/arm-smmu: Allow client devices to select direct mapping
Date
This series allows drm devices to set a default identity
mapping using iommu_request_dm_for_dev(). First patch is
a cleanup to support other SoCs to call into QCOM specific
implementation and preparation for second patch.
Second patch sets the default identity domain for drm devices.

Jordan Crouse (1):
iommu/arm-smmu: Allow client devices to select direct mapping

Sai Prakash Ranjan (1):
iommu: arm-smmu-impl: Convert to a generic reset implementation
